摘要
Recently, both sulfilimines and deuterated organic molecules have garnered considerable attention in organic synthesis, drug discovery, and agrochemicals. Herein, we present a base-mediated efficient synthetic route for synthesizing trideuteromethyl sulfilimines from sulfenamides utilizing cost-effective and readily accessible CD3OTs as an electrophilic trideuteromethyl source. A wide array of both aryl and alkyl trideuteromethyl sulfilimines were prepared in high yields with excellent deuterium incorporation. The present approach is scalable, and the consequent products can be diversified into various trideuteromethyl sulfur derivatives.
